An EC210 Volvo Excavator: In-Depth Dive into Vecu Systems
The EC210 Volvo Excavator is a robust machine known for its efficiency. One of the key components that sets it apart is the integrated Vecu system. This sophisticated technology plays a crucial role in optimizing the excavator's overall performance. Vecu systems use electronic devices to acquire data on various aspects of the machine, such as engine parameters, hydraulic pressure, and working conditions. This data is then processed by a main control unit to regulate the excavator's systems in real time.

Simulating Truck ECU for Volvo: Advanced Diagnostics and Tuning
Volvo trucks are renowned for their performance and advanced technological features. Simulating the Engine Control Unit (ECU) allows technicians to delve into these intricate systems, providing a powerful tool for both diagnostics and tuning. This simulation environment mirrors the real-world behavior of the ECU, enabling comprehensive analysis of engine parameters, sensor data, and control strategies. By adjusting virtual parameters within the simulated ECU, technicians can pinpoint fault codes, test software updates, and optimize performance for specific applications. This approach offers a safe and controlled platform to explore various scenarios without impacting the original vehicle hardware.
- The ability to simulate different driving conditions provides valuable insights into how the ECU responds to varying loads and environmental factors.
- Advanced diagnostics tools integrated with the simulation environment can identify potential issues before they manifest in the physical truck, minimizing downtime and repair costs.
- Tuning the simulated ECU allows technicians to optimize fuel efficiency, power output, and emissions performance based on individual customer requirements.

Engine Control Unit Simulators for Volvo Trucks: Virtual Testing Grounds
Developing and refining the Electronic Control Units (ECUs) governing Volvo trucks requires meticulous testing in various range of simulated situations. ECU simulation software empowers engineers to develop highly realistic virtual testbeds that replicate the challenges of real-world driving scenarios. These simulations provide a safe and controlled setting for testing ECU performance under uncommon conditions, such as changing temperatures, terrain, and pressures.
- Pros of using ECU simulation software include reduced development time, cost savings through elimination of physical prototypes, and the ability to detect potential issues early in the design process.
